Legislators Query Holder on NSA Phone Records
Testifying before a previously scheduled Senate Appropriations subcommittee hearing on the Justice Department's budget, U.S. Attorney General Eric Holder on Thursday was met with questions regarding Wednesday's report by Britain's Guardian newspaper that the National Security Agency has been secretly collecting phone records of tens of millions of Americans who use Verizon as their landline or cell phone carrier. ...

South Korea Accepts North's Surprise Offer of Talks
South Korea is proposing a date and venue for talks with North Korea. The proposal comes just hours after Pyongyang made a surprise offer for talks on a wide range of issues and said it would leave it up to Seoul to choose the timing and location. This marks a significant reversal of tensions on the peninsula, which had been ...

Navy Names Multiple Ships
Secretary of the Navy Ray Mabus announced the next three joint high speed vessels (JHSV) will be named USNS Yuma, USNS Bismarck and USNS Burlington, and two littoral combat ships (LCS) will be named USS Billings and USS Tulsa. ...

Last Type 42 warship decommissions
HMS Edinburgh, the last of the Royal Navy's Type 42 destroyers, officially bows out of service, Thursday 6 June.

Ban regrets Austria's decision to withdraw troops from UN mission in Golan Heights
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on said he regrets Austria's decision to withdraw its troops from the United Nations peacekeeping force in the Golan Heights, which has faced a number of security risks and operational challenges in recent months amid the escalating conflict in Syria. ...
